First of all this was a mech produced by House Kurita which has a definite Japanese influence. It was a prideful mech and they named it after the house symbol.

Second in eastern Asian cultures, dragons normally were considered water/ocean deities. They were also more sinuous and serpent like versus the lizard based western dragons.

I just wish the Dragon mech had three fingers (Japanese) instead of four (chinese) *sigh*
